How to Turn Internal Stories into Employee Advocacy with Matt See
Most employees have no idea what’s really happening inside their own company — and that’s exactly why so many advocacy programs fall flat. Matt See has spent his career transforming internal comms at massive organizations, and he’s discovered something most leaders miss: employee advocacy doesn’t start with LinkedIn posts or social-media training. It starts inside. In this episode, Matt and Rhona dig into how internal storytelling can transform culture, inspire authentic advocacy, and turn your employees into your best brand ambassadors — without a single content calendar.
